Another Friday outing for Gonzalez

Marussia reserve driver Rodolfo Gonzalez will replace Max Chilton in Friday's first practice for the Spanish Grand Prix. The 26-year-old, who is backed by Venezuelan oil company PDVSA, joined Marussia at the start of this season and made his debut at a grand prix weekend last time out in Bahrain. Gonzalez replaced Jules Bianchi for the opening practice at the Sakhir circuit and finished bottom of the timesheets, eight-tenths behind Chilton. However, for this weekend's Spanish GP it is the Brit he will replace, contesting first practice at the Barcelona circuit alongside Jules Bianchi. Chilton will be back in the car for FP2.
